BATTERY CELLS WITH TABS AT RIGHT ANGLES - A simplified explanation of the abstract

This abstract first appeared for US patent application 18444465 titled 'BATTERY CELLS WITH TABS AT RIGHT ANGLES

The abstract describes a battery design with terminals on one side of the housing, an electrode stack inside, and current collectors with tabs extending in a direction perpendicular to the housing.

  • The battery housing has terminals on one side for electrical connections.
  • An electrode stack, including an anode current collector and a cathode current collector, is positioned within the housing.
  • The anode current collector has an anode tab on one side and is electrically coupled with the first terminal.
  • The cathode current collector has a cathode tab on one side and is electrically coupled with the second terminal.
  • The tabs of the current collectors extend in a direction normal to the housing's side.

Original Abstract Submitted

Batteries according to embodiments of the present technology may include a housing including a first terminal disposed on a first side of the housing and a second terminal disposed on the first side of the housing. The batteries may include an electrode stack positioned within the housing. The electrode stack may include an anode current collector. The anode current collector may define an anode tab along a second side of the anode current collector, and be electrically coupled with the first terminal. The electrode stack may include a cathode current collector. The cathode current collector may define a cathode tab along a second side of the cathode current collector. The cathode tab and anode tab may extend in a direction normal to a direction facing the first side of the housing. The cathode tab may be electrically coupled with the second terminal.
